Transaction f51d87892dc73123799379f5b76bccfc7e41a1748428ddb3281a4f34b6851439
2 Input
2 Outputs
- f51d87892dc73123799379f5b76bccfc7e41a1748428ddb3281a4f34b6851439:0
- f51d87892dc73123799379f5b76bccfc7e41a1748428ddb3281a4f34b6851439:1
value 35518
address 1EQV8YkDChbSDyazjfVz8QA6MkeSsA4YXe
value 5124500
address 17YaJ7dAmNEU9jJZjysMQPVSGFsogcH9f2